Nicholas Piggin <npig...@gmail.com> writes: > Provide a dt_cpu_ftrs= cmdline option to disable the dt_cpu_ftrs CPU > feature discovery, and fall back to the "cputable" based version.
I don't think this works properly. > diff --git a/arch/powerpc/kernel/dt_cpu_ftrs.c > b/arch/powerpc/kernel/dt_cpu_ftrs.c > index fcc7588a96d6..050925b5b451 100644 > --- a/arch/powerpc/kernel/dt_cpu_ftrs.c > +++ b/arch/powerpc/kernel/dt_cpu_ftrs.c > @@ -775,6 +785,16 @@ bool __init dt_cpu_ftrs_in_use(void) > > bool __init dt_cpu_ftrs_init(void *fdt) > { > + if (!using_dt_cpu_ftrs) { > + /* > + * This should never happen because this runs before > + * early_praam, however if the init ordering changes, > + * test if early_param has disabled this. > + */ > + return false; > + } > + using_dt_cpu_ftrs = false; > + > /* Setup and verify the FDT, if it fails we just bail */ > if (!early_init_dt_verify(fdt)) > return false; ... return true; Because this runs before early_param(), as you mention, dt_cpu_ftrs_init() returns true, which means we skip calling identify_cpu(). So although passing dt_cpu_ftrs=off will skip the later logic, it doesn't cause us to call identify_cpu() in early_setup() which it should. In practice it works because the base CPU spec that we initialise in dt_cpu_ftrs.c is mostly OK, and skiboot also adds the cpu-version property which causes us to call identify_cpu() again later, but that's all a bit fragile IMHO. So unfortunately I think we need to add logic in dt_cpu_ftrs_init() to look for dt_cpu_ftrs=off on the command line. The patch below seems to work, but would appreciate more eyes on it. cheers diff --git a/arch/powerpc/kernel/dt_cpu_ftrs.c b/arch/powerpc/kernel/dt_cpu_ftrs.c index d6f05e4dc328..9a560954498a 100644 --- a/arch/powerpc/kernel/dt_cpu_ftrs.c +++ b/arch/powerpc/kernel/dt_cpu_ftrs.c @@ -8,6 +8,7 @@ #include <linux/export.h> #include <linux/init.h> #include <linux/jump_label.h> +#include <linux/libfdt.h> #include <linux/memblock.h> #include <linux/printk.h> #include <linux/sched.h> @@ -767,6 +770,26 @@ static void __init cpufeatures_setup_finished(void) cur_cpu_spec->cpu_features, cur_cpu_spec->mmu_features); } +static int __init disabled_on_cmdline(void) +{ + unsigned long root, chosen; + const char *p; + + root = of_get_flat_dt_root(); + chosen = of_get_flat_dt_subnode_by_name(root, "chosen"); + if (chosen == -FDT_ERR_NOTFOUND) + return false; + + p = of_get_flat_dt_prop(chosen, "bootargs", NULL); + if (!p) + return false; + + if (strstr(p, "dt_cpu_ftrs=off")) + return true; + + return false; +} + static int __init fdt_find_cpu_features(unsigned long node, const char *uname, int depth, void *data) { @@ -801,6 +826,9 @@ bool __init dt_cpu_ftrs_init(void *fdt) if (!of_scan_flat_dt(fdt_find_cpu_features, NULL)) return false; + if (disabled_on_cmdline()) + return false; + cpufeatures_setup_cpu(); using_dt_cpu_ftrs = true;
